Guillermo Saenz, alias Memo, is Chef at “La Palapa Restaurant”, Hotel Cuna del Ángel. Chef Memo has a long history as a gastronome, trained in Spain and Italy.
He worked for several years in well-known international restaurants in San José. This allowed him to create an expansive vision of high end-cuisine and legendary dishes fusing with tropical ingredients from Costa Rica.
In 2011, he moved to Costa Ballena to dedicate his expertise to La Palapa Restaurant at the enchanting Cuna del Ángel Hotel. In 2013,
Chef Memo and his team started with a “gluten-free” project to also satisfy celiac guests. For months they researched, tested, and perfected the recipes until also the bread had a consistency that was approved by Don Tom, the owner of the angelic hotel.
And in 2014, the La Palapa Restaurant was declared 100% gluten-free. It was the first of its nature in Costa Rica.
Everybody, big and small, intolerant or not, diners can now choose from a wide range of exquisite international dishes and enjoy a homemade ice cream or a delicate crème brûlée for dessert. All meals are full of flavor and extraordinary quality that you, celiac or not, won´t notice the difference.
The own permaculture Project “Finca Heartsong”, delivers fresh herbs, some hydroponic vegetables, ingredients for the famous “Jungle Salad”, tropical fruit and cacao for desserts and ice cream.
And creative Chef Memo will pamper all your senses, serving 100% gluten-free and gourmet dining with a selected choice of wines and incredible views.
